AARP took legal action against, contending that a 30 percent reward or charge made a worker's disclosure of ADA- and GINA-protected details spontaneous. In the summer season of 2017, a district court agreed with AARP and sent the policies back to the EEOC for more modifications. HIPAA bans group health strategies from discriminating versus individuals based on health-status factors.


Things about General Wellness


The incentive or penalty have to be restricted to 30 percent of the expense of the premium for the health insurance and half for programs connected to decrease of tobacco use. (Remember, a motivation of 30% click to read is not presently enabled under the ADA and GINA). The program should be reasonably developed to promote wellness or protect against illness.


Notification should be provided of the schedule of an affordable option. Participatory health care are generally certified with HIPAA so long as involvement in the program is offered to all likewise located individuals, regardless of health and wellness standing. There is no limitation on financial incentives for participatory health cares. A program that reimburses all or component of the expense of membership in a fitness facility.


A program that motivates preventative care by forgoing the co-payment or deductible demand for the prices of services like prenatal treatment or well-baby check outs. A program that compensates workers for the price of a smoking cessation program without respect to whether the employee stops smoking cigarettes. A program that our website offers an incentive to employees for going to a month-to-month health education workshop.

Typical wellness programs depend on hard-copy handouts, instructor-led courses and mentoring in person or by telephone. All are tough to deliver when workers work at several sites, and they can be fairly expensive. Today, web-based options can supply the exact same information to a limitless variety of employees, 1 day a day, from any place with Net gain access to and for a portion of the cost.


See Health Portals Help Fill Employee Requirement. Scalability is one of the most noticeable advantages of online shipment. In the past, wellness and health initiatives were typically restricted to employees at headquarters. Organizations with several websites or with great deals of field or remote workers had difficulty distributing, collecting and tracking details.


Numerous online health programs can occupy a record of current health and wellness concerns and advised goals and action strategies based upon the outcomes of a staff member's health and wellness threat evaluation. Modern technology can additionally improve the affordability of commonly pricey high-touch interventions, such as instructor-led education and learning and training. Online personal training can effectively imitate an in person or telephone training experience for regarding one-fifth the price.
